Building Strong Employee Relations: A Guide to Success in the Workplace

In today's fast-paced and ever-evolving work environment, it is crucial for organizations to prioritize employee relations. A positive and open relationship between employees and employers not only fosters a healthy work culture but also leads to increased productivity and employee satisfaction. However, many employers often overlook the strategic importance of employee relations and conflict management. To address this issue, it is essential to provide employees with a pathway to raise concerns, share feedback, and promote transparency.

One way to cultivate a culture of transparency and open communication is by utilizing employee relations software. This software can serve as a valuable tool in facilitating employee-employer relationships by providing a platform for feedback, issue resolution, and policy access. By leveraging this technology, organizations can empower employees to voice their concerns and contribute to the decision-making process. Additionally, HR departments can support line managers by equipping them with a toolkit of policies and procedures that outline best practices for managing employee relations.

To ensure the success of employee relations initiatives, it is vital to focus on continuous improvement. By regularly assessing the effectiveness of existing measures and identifying areas for enhancement, organizations can strengthen their employee relations efforts. This can encompass various aspects, including performance management, flexible working requests, restructures, absence management, wellbeing support, and conflict resolution. By addressing these critical areas, employers can proactively address potential issues and create a positive work environment.

In the realm of employee relations, the role of an employee relations specialist is crucial. These professionals possess problem-solving skills and the ability to analyze different arguments. They play a pivotal role in advising managers on the benefits, risks, and implications of various options available. Additionally, they assist in drafting outcome letters and undertake project work, such as developing and delivering in-house training on employment law for case managers.

To ensure effective employee relations, here are three actionable pieces of advice:

  • 1. Foster open communication channels: Establish clear pathways for employees to raise concerns and provide feedback. Encourage a culture of transparency by utilizing employee relations software and ensuring that policies and resources are readily accessible to all employees.
  • 2. Provide training and support: Equip line managers with the necessary tools and knowledge to handle employee relations effectively. This can include training sessions on conflict resolution, performance management, and employment law. By empowering managers, organizations can promote consistency and fairness in handling employee relations.
  • 3. Regularly assess and improve: Continuously evaluate the effectiveness of your employee relations initiatives and identify areas for improvement. Seek feedback from employees and monitor key metrics related to employee satisfaction and engagement. Taking a proactive approach to address potential issues will help create a positive work environment and enhance overall productivity.

In conclusion, prioritizing employee relations is essential for organizations to thrive in today's competitive landscape. By fostering open communication, providing necessary support and training, and consistently evaluating and improving initiatives, employers can build strong employee-employer relationships. This, in turn, leads to positive employee experiences, increased productivity, and an overall thriving work culture.
